Capacity and Size Considerations

While sturdy materials protect your pup’s dinner, getting the right bowl size is just as important.

Your dog’s food capacity needs depend on their size and eating habits. Finding the right dog bowl size is essential for their health and wellbeing.

For large dogs, you’ll want bowls holding 4-8 cups, while smaller pups do fine with 2-3 cup portions.

Remember, oversized bowls can make portions look smaller, leading to overfeeding. Match the bowl size to your dog’s recommended meal volume for healthy portions.

Elevated and Spill-Proof Designs

Two game-changing innovations in dog bowls are making mealtime better for your pup.

Elevated feeders reduce strain on your dog’s neck and back while promoting better digestion.

They’re especially helpful for larger breeds or seniors with joint issues.

Spill-proof designs with floating covers and non-skid bases keep water contained and food in place, making cleanup a breeze for even the messiest eaters.

Preventing Bloating and Improving Digestion

Preventing Bloating and Improving Digestion
Beyond supporting your pup’s posture, you need to watch for gulping habits.

Slow feeder bowls tackle digestive issues by creating maze-like patterns that prevent fast eating. These smart feeding strategies work wonders for gut health and nutrient balance.

Bowl Design Digestive Benefit
Honeycomb Pattern Prevents bloating in puppies and adults
Textured Ridges Reduces gas while providing mental stimulation
Anti-gulping Design Eliminates choking hazards during excited eating

Consider slow feeding as "speed bumps for your pup’s stomach" – they eat slower, digest better, which is essential for overall digestive issues and nutrient balance.

Choosing Right Material and Design

Regarding dog bowl materials, you’ve got options.

Stainless steel dog bowls are durable, hygienic, and easy to clean.

Ceramic options offer design variety, while plastic is affordable.

For eco-friendly choices, look for bamboo or recycled materials.

The right material and design depend on your pup’s needs.

Considering a no spill solution can also help reduce and make cleaning easier.

Material Benefits
Stainless Steel Durable, hygienic, easy to clean
Ceramic Design variety, heavyweight
Plastic Affordable, lightweight
Bamboo/Recycled Eco-friendly
